Job description

SUMMARY DESCRIPTION:

Kids Unlimited of Oregon is looking for individuals to assist with running high quality after school programs in 8 Medford After School programs. We will need a variety of youth development specialists to serve different roles within the organization supporting student learning and development.


PERFORMANCE R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• Serve as a key after school or school support staff.
  • Develop games, curriculum, projects, and activities to engage youth.
  • Participate in professional development pertinent to duties assigned by Kids Unlimited Leadership.
  • Assist with the supervision of students while promoting activities to enhance the social, emotional, intellectual and physical development of students.
  • Maintain the same high level of ethical behavior and confidentiality of information about students as expected of the teacher.
  • Give teachers or Site Managers an additional source of feedback and of ideas concerning activities while working with a group of students to reinforce learning of material or skills.
  • Operate and care for equipment used in the program for instructional or recreational purposes.
  • Actively participate in program improvement.
  • Other job duties as assigned.

KNOWLEDGE, ABILITIES, AND SKILLS:

Fluency in Spanish strongly preferred.


Knowledge of developmentally appropriate activities, material, and play for early childhood, elementary, and middle-school aged students.


EDUCATION, TRAINING, AND EXPERIENCE:

Prior experience in an elementary, middle school, or early childhood program


PHYSICAL DEMANDS:

Special requirements such as lifting heavy objects (i.e. 25 lbs.) and frequent climbing. Ability to move around the classroom including stooping, bending, standing for extended periods and moving heavy objects. Crisis intervention may require participating in physical restraints (training will be provided if the individual has not been trained in physical restraint).


SPECIAL REQUIREMENTS:

May be asked to attend/participate in special programs or activities outside the instructional day.
